Basic Router Configuration

Before we dive into the advanced settings, let's cover the basics. Here are the essential steps to install and configure your router:

1. Physical Installation

First, locate a convenient spot for your router, such as an open floor space or table. Make sure it's away from walls, appliances, and other potential obstructions that could interfere with your Wi-Fi signal.

2. Power On and IP Configuration

Plug in your router, turn it on, and configure it with your IP address (usually 192.168.0.1 or 192.168.100.1). The default IP address can be found on the label on the back of your router or in the user manual.

3. Access Point Settings

Configure your access point settings, including the wireless network name (SSID), password (WPA2 key), and wireless channel.

4. DHCP Settings

Enable the DHCP server on your router, which will assign IP addresses to devices on your network.

Security Measures

Securing your Wi-Fi network is essential to prevent unauthorized access and hacking. Here are some security measures to take:

1. Change Default Passwords

Change the default admin password and wireless password to strong, unique credentials.

2. Enable WPA2 Encryption

WPA2 (Wi-Fi Protected Access 2) is the most secure encryption standard for Wi-Fi. Make sure it's enabled on your router.

Advanced Router Configuration

Once you've covered the basics and security measures, it's time to explore advanced router configuration options:

1. QoS (Quality of Service) Settings

Configure QoS settings to prioritize traffic and ensure that critical applications, such as video conferencing, receive sufficient bandwidth.

2. Advanced Wireless Settings

Configure advanced wireless settings, such as channel bonding and beamforming, to improve wireless performance and signal strength.

3. Firewall Settings

Configure your firewall settings to block unwanted incoming traffic and prevent hacking attempts.

4. Scheduled Reboot and Maintenance

Schedule regular reboots and maintenance tasks to keep your router up to date and running smoothly.

Mesh Wi-Fi Systems

Mesh Wi-Fi systems are a type of wireless network that uses multiple access points to provide seamless coverage throughout your home. Here's what you need to know:

Benefits

Mesh Wi-Fi systems offer several benefits, including: * Improved coverage and signal strength * Reduced interference and dropped connections * Easy setup and management

Popular Mesh Wi-Fi Routers

Some popular mesh Wi-Fi routers include: * Google Wifi * Netgear Orbi * Linksys Velop

Setup and Configuration
